    Quote Originally Posted by Rick1970 View Post
    Really need to do this with the case in my rangie. It leaks there, and guessing with over 600k on it now the chances of just replacing the o-ring for a fix are quite slim.


    How is the setup on the mill bed? Just clamp down and good to go, or packing required?
    I clamped the case down with the machined areas of the bottom (rear) face sitting on a pair of wide parallels.

    Info for those who undertake this job, the bush does in fact need to have a step. The first one that I did, shown in this thread, migrated inwards despite some permanent-assembly Loctite. The gearbox will prevent outwards migration.
